America the Beautiful National Parks Pass

The number one must have gifts for National Park lovers is the annual America the Beautiful National Parks pass. For $80, this pass covers entrance fees to any one of the 63 National Parks and more than 2,000 federally managed forests and recreation areas.

National Parks Passport Stamp Book

Did you know, every National Park has a unique passport stamp you can collect for free? Collecting stamps is a unique way to remember your National Park travels throughout the years. Plus its the perfect souvenir that doesn’t take up any space!

National Parks lovers can start collecting stamps from their journeys in the official Passport to Your National Parks stamp book, which has stamp space for all NPS sites, color-coded by region. These Passport books are sold in all National Park gift shops, (and online) and every purchase goes towards funding educational and interpretive programs at NPS sites!

National Parks WPA Poster Calendar

This retro-inspired calendar features 12 months of vintage National Parks travel posters, created by the Works Progress Administration during the 1930’s.
